8.7 存储过程 (Stored Procedures)


文档摘要

8.7 存储过程 (Stored Procedures) PostgreSQL 存储过程详解 PostgreSQL 的存储过程是预编译的 SQL 代码块,可以像函数一样被调用执行。它们允许你将复杂的业务逻辑封装到数据库服务器端,从而提高代码的可重用性、安全性和性能。与函数相比,存储过程主要区别在于它们可以执行事务控制语句,并且不一定需要返回值。 本文将深入探讨 PostgreSQL 存储过程的各个方面,包括创建、调用、参数传递、事务控制、错误处理以及一些最佳实践。 创建存储过程 使用 语句来创建存储过程。基本语法如下: : 如果已经存在同名的存储过程,则替换它。 : 存储过程的名称。 : 参数名称。 : 参数类型。 : 输入参数 (默认值)。 : 输出参数。 : 既是输入又是输出参数。


发布者: 作者: 转发
评论区 (0)
U